Air Resource Heat Pumps vs. Geothermal Warmth Pumps



When taking into consideration Air Resource Heat Pumps vs. Geothermal Heat Pumps for your home, there are key differences to remember.

Air Source Warm Pumps remove heat from the outside air and are a lot more usual due to lower setup costs. heat pumps riverlea work well in modest climates yet may be less effective in severe cold.

Geothermal Heat Pumps, on the other hand, utilize warm from the ground, offering constant heating and cooling no matter outside temperatures. While they've greater upfront expenses, they're a lot more energy-efficient in the long run and have a longer life-span.

Air Source Heat Pumps are much easier to set up and keep compared to Geothermal Heat Pumps, which require more intricate underground setups. Nevertheless, Geothermal Heat Pumps deal better power financial savings over time, making them a more eco-friendly choice.



Consider your environment, spending plan, and lasting goals when selecting in between these two types of heat pumps for your home.

Efficiency Comparison: Police Officer and HSPF Ratings



For a complete comparison of Air Source Warmth Pumps and Geothermal Warm Pumps, understanding their effectiveness through COP (Coefficient of Efficiency) and HSPF (Heating Seasonal Performance Variable) ratings is important. Police measures the home heating or cooling result of a heat pump contrasted to the power it consumes. On the other hand, HSPF concentrates especially on the home heating efficiency of a heat pump over a whole home heating season. It considers aspects like defrost cycles and standby losses. Geothermal Warmth Pumps often tend to have greater HSPF ratings because of their secure below ground temperature level resource.

When comparing performance based upon police and HSPF rankings, Geothermal Warmth Pumps typically come out on top. They provide higher effectiveness levels, which can result in lower energy expenses gradually.

However, upfront costs might be greater for Geothermal Heat Pumps, so it's vital to think about both efficiency and price factors when choosing the very best option for your home.

Expense Evaluation: Installment and Procedure Expenses



Considering the expenses associated with both installment and operation is essential when comparing Air Resource Heat Pumps and Geothermal Warmth Pumps. Air Resource Warmth Pumps are typically a lot more inexpensive to mount ahead of time compared to Geothermal Heat Pumps. The installation of a Geothermal Heat Pump includes extra intricate below ground work, making it a more expensive option initially. Nevertheless, Geothermal Heat Pumps are understood for their higher performance, which can cause lower functional costs over time.

When it comes to operational expenditures, Geothermal Warmth Pumps tend to be much more economical in the long run because of their greater effectiveness and reduced power intake. They can provide considerable financial savings on cooling and heating bills, balancing out the higher installment prices.

Air Source Warmth Pumps, while having lower ahead of time expenses, may cause slightly higher operational expenses due to the fact that they aren't as effective as their geothermal equivalents.

Inevitably, the very best choice for your home depends on your spending plan, lasting energy goals, and details home heating and cooling requirements. Consider both the setup and procedure expenses thoroughly before choosing.
